Eddie Cibrian is the ultimate playboy. At least he will be in a new NBC drama by that name, set in 1960s Chicago, replacing Hellcats' Jeff Hephner in the leading role.

Hephner landed the role last week after a marathon of auditions, but was replaced in a surprise move by Cibrian. The decision was made after the pilot’s table read.

Sources close to the show tell TV Line that Hephner, who had never played a lead on a series, was great in the tests but ultimately the part just wasn’t a good fit.

Eddie Cibrian is expected start immediately as Playboy - set at the Playboy Club in Chicago in 1963 - is slated to begin filming in the Windy City early next week.

It centers on Nick Dalton (Cibrian), described as “the ultimate playboy.” He is an attorney in Chicago and a Keyholder at the glamorous, exclusive Playboy Club.

He's also a "fixer" with mob ties. Laura Benanti, Amber Heard, Naturi Naughton, Jenna Dewan-Tatum, Leah Renee, David Krumholtz and Wes Ramsey co-star.

Cibrian was formerly on CSI: Miami, but is perhaps just as well known these days in celebrity gossip circles for his affair with LeAnn Rimes (now his fiancee).
